草庐IT

高效化

全部标签

[开源]Web端的P2P文件传输工具,简单安全高效的P2P文件传输服务

一、开源项目简介小鹿快传-在线P2P文件传输工具小鹿快传是一款Web端的P2P文件传输工具,使用了WebRTC技术实现P2P连接和文件传输。二、开源协议使用MIT开源协议三、界面展示产品截图四、功能概述简单安全高效的P2P文件传输服务小鹿快传是一款Web端的P2P文件传输工具,使用了WebRTC技术实现P2P连接和文件传输。简单无需登录只需要选择好想要发送的文件,然后将生成的下载链接发送给对方即可开始传送。安全小鹿快传使用P2P技术,文件数据不走服务器,直接发送给对方,且数据自带加密,免去隐私被泄漏的风险。高效由于使用P2P技术,文件传输速度不会受到服务器性能的影响,完全取决于你和对方的网速。

使用IntelliJ IDEA高效进行Java代码分析和性能调优

1引言在软件开发中,性能优化的重要性是不容忽视的。在使用Java编写应用程序时,性能调优是流程中不可或缺的环节,能够提高应用程序速度、减少Java虚拟机(JVM)的延迟。本文介绍如何使用IntelliJIDEA进行Java性能分析和调优,并深入了解其内置的性能分析工具以及如何利用其来改进应用程序性能。2性能分析简介在深入了解IntelliJIDEA的性能分析工具之前,有必要先了解性能分析的概念。性能分析器是一种测量应用程序使用的资源(CPU、内存、磁盘I/O等)的工具。性能分析涉及动态分析应用程序,并提供有关CPU使用情况、内存管理、线程争用等方面的见解。IntelliJIDEA是JetBra

Python文件操作:高效处理文件的技巧

文件操作是日常工作中不可或缺的一部分。无论是读取、写入、拷贝还是移动文件,都需要高效的文件操作技巧。本文将带领读者深入探索文件操作的世界,并分享实用的技巧和工具。通过掌握这些技能,您将能够更加轻松地管理和处理文件,提高工作效率和数据处理能力。一、文件读写操作在学习文件操作之前,先来回顾一下编码的相关以及数据类型的知识。字符串类型(str),在程序中用于表示文字信息,本质上是unicode编码中的二进制。name="lisa"字节类型(bytes),可表示文字信息,本质上是utf-8/gbk等编码的二进制(对unicode进行压缩,方便文件存储和网络传输。)name="lisa"data=nam

计算机毕设-SpringBoot+VUE高效便捷的云存储平台——百度网盘

作者主页:编程指南针作者简介:Java领域优质创作者、CSDN博客专家、CSDN内容合伙人、掘金特邀作者、阿里云博客专家、51CTO特邀作者、多年架构师设计经验、腾讯课堂常驻讲师主要内容:Java项目、Python项目、前端项目、人工智能与大数据、简历模板、学习资料、面试题库、技术互助收藏点赞不迷路 关注作者有好处文末获取源码 项目编号:一,环境介绍语言环境:Java: jdk1.8数据库:Mysql:mysql5.7应用服务器:Tomcat: tomcat8.5.31开发工具:IDEA或eclipse二,项目简介随着信息技术的不断发展,云存储作为一种高效便捷的数据存储方式,越来越受到人们的青

高效爬虫:如何使用Python Scrapy库提升数据采集速度?

Scrapy是一个强大而灵活的Python爬虫框架,被广泛用于数据采集、网站抓取和网络爬虫开发。本文将深入介绍Scrapy的功能和用法,并提供丰富的示例代码,帮助更好地理解和应用。一、Scrapy简介1、什么是Scrapy?Scrapy是一个用于抓取网站数据的Python框架。它提供了一个强大的爬虫引擎,能够轻松处理网页的下载、数据提取、数据存储等任务。Scrapy的设计目标是高效、可扩展和灵活,使开发者能够快速构建各种类型的网络爬虫。2、Scrapy的特点Scrapy具有以下重要特点:强大的爬虫引擎:Scrapy引擎处理并发请求、调度请求和处理下载的响应,使爬虫高效运行。灵活的数据提取:使用

【程序员必备】UE4 C++ 虚幻引擎:详解JSON文件读、写、解析,打造高效开发!

目录0应用场景1功能前瞻1.1JSON格式介绍2功能实现2.1准备工作2.2注意事项2.3具体功能实现2.3.1ReadJSONFileByFN函数实现2.3.2WriteJSONFile函数实现2.3.3疑惑🙋‍♂️作者:海码007📜专栏:UE虚幻引擎专栏💥标题:【程序员必备】UE4C++虚幻引擎:详解JSON文件读、写、解析,打造高效开发!❣️寄语:人生的意义或许可以发挥自己全部的潜力,所以加油吧!🎈最后:文章作者技术和水平有限,如果文中出现错误,希望大家能指正0应用场景在游戏开发中,Json文件常被用来保存游戏数据或配置参数,如把游戏对象的内部状态存储到磁盘文件,即序列化游戏对象的时候,

广州生物实验室装修:打造安全、高效的生物实验环境

生物科技的迅速发展,生物实验室的需求不断增加。生物实验室是进行生物科学研究、实验和测试的重要场所。在广州这个南方城市,生物实验室的建设和装修成为一个热门话题。SICOLAB喜格实验室将探讨广州生物实验室装修的原则、设计、装修材料选择以及细节问题等方面,为打造安全、高效的生物实验环境提供参考。一、广州生物实验室装修的原则1.安全第一:广州生物实验室装修的首要原则是确保实验室的安全。这包括实验室的布局、设备选择、环境控制以及紧急情况下的疏散措施等方面。应严格按照国家及地方的相关法规和标准进行设计和装修。2.符合科研需求:广州生物实验室的装修应充分考虑科研的需求,为科研人员提供方便、舒适和高效的实验

java - 如何提高效率?

我正在创建一个Asteroids克隆,但有更多的花里胡哨。截至目前,我有一个ArrayList将所有小行星都显示在屏幕上。每一个都有一个Vector与之关联并扩展我的通用GameObject处理绘图和更新以及每个游戏对象共有的其他常见事物的类。也就是说,每次我摧毁一颗小行星时,我都会创造一个新的Asteroid对象并将其添加到ArrayList...发生这种情况时会出现明显的滞后,因为我还创建了爆炸粒子,我认为这是GC。我的想法是,我可以预先创建一个对象池并重新使用它们,而不是即时创建新对象。这是正确的想法吗?另外,最有组织、最有效的方法是什么?任何其他想法也很好。只是试图减少所有这些

对比Elasticsearch,使用Doris进行高效日志分析

作为公司数据资产的重要组成部分,日志在系统的可观察性、网络安全和数据分析方面扮演着关键角色。日志记录是故障排除的首选工具,也是提升系统安全性的重要参考。日志还是一个宝贵的数据源,通过对其进行分析,可以获取指导业务增长的有价值信息。日志是计算机系统中事件的顺序记录。一个理想的日志分析系统应该是:具备无模式支持。 原始日志是非结构化的自由文本,基本无法直接进行聚合和计算,因此,在将日志用于数据库或数据仓库进行分析之前,需要将其转化为结构化的表格形式(这个过程称为“ETL”)。如果发生日志模式更改,需要在ETL流程和结构化表中进行一系列复杂的调整。为了应对此情况,可以使用半结构化日志,主要采用JSO

“Layui用户认证:实现安全高效的登录和注册体验”

目录1.什么是layui2.layui、easyui与bootstrap的对比3.layui入门4.构建登录页面5.构建注册页面6.总结1.什么是layuilayui(谐音:类UI)是一套开源的WebUI解决方案,采用自身经典的模块化规范,并遵循原生HTML/CSS/JS的开发方式,极易上手,拿来即用。其风格简约轻盈,而组件优雅丰盈,从源代码到使用方法的每一处细节都经过精心雕琢,非常适合网页界面的快速开发。layui区别于那些基于MVVM底层的前端框架,却并非逆道而行,而是信奉返璞归真之道。准确地说,它更多是面向后端开发者,你无需涉足前端各种工具,只需面对浏览器本身,让一切你所需要的元素与交互